How they compare

Micronesia, Federated States of currently reports 6,785 number against 5,455 number in United States Virgin Islands, a difference of 1,330 number.

That makes Micronesia, Federated States of's figure about 1.2 times United States Virgin Islands's.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 16 shared years of data; in 1982 it was United States Virgin Islands ahead.

Micronesia, Federated States of ranks 181st and United States Virgin Islands ranks 184th of 205 countries.

Across the 2 decades both report, Micronesia, Federated States of averaged higher in 1 and United States Virgin Islands in 1.
